Stertil-Koni Debuts Heavy Duty Shop Equipment Tailored for Aviation

05/04/2020 | 2020

STEVENSVILLE, MD May 4, 2020 – Heavy duty vehicle lift leader Stertil-Koni today announced liftoff for its expanded line of Shop Equipment – in this case several key systems engineered specifically for the aviation sector.

Two of the initial products in the expanded Stertil-Koni line of heavy duty Shop Equipment work in conjunction with one another to assist technicians in performing brake and tire repair as well as landing gear maintenance and servicing.

 

 

The products are:

1.      A hydraulic wheel dolly for aircraft wheels and tires (Model SKWTA500) – with a capacity of 1,100 lbs.; and

2.      Air/hydraulic commercial aircraft jacks for main landing and nose gear (Models SK65-1AP and SK25-2AP) – with capacities of 143,000lbs. and 55,000 lbs. respectively.

About Stertil-Koni

Stertil-Koni is the market leader in heavy duty vehicle lifts, notably bus lifts and truck lifts, and proudly serves municipalities, state agencies, school bus fleets, major corporations, the U.S. Military and more. Stertil-Koni's breadth of products meets all ranges of lifting needs and includes portable lifts such as Mobile Column Lifts, 2-post, 4-post, inground piston lifts, platform lifts, and its axle-engaging, inground, scissor lift configuration, ECOLIFT. The company’s innovative, inground telescopic piston DIAMONDLIFT is now available with an optional Continuous Recess system, ideal for low clearance vehicles. Stertil-Koni USA is headquartered in Stevensville, Maryland with production facilities in Europe, The Netherlands, and Streator, IL.
